Events from the year 1201 in Ireland.
Incumbent[]
- Lord: John
Events[]
- William de Braose was installed by King John of England as the chief tenant of a very substantial territory encompassing most of the modern County Tipperary
- William de Burgh appointed Seneschal of Munster (Royal Governor)
